Ford Diesel Engine Repair Mistakes You Ought to By no means Make
Ford diesel engines are known for their strength, towing power, and long-term durability, however they are additionally advanced machines that demand careful maintenance and exact repairs. Whether you own a Super Duty truck for work, hauling, or every day driving, one incorrect move throughout a repair can lead to costly damage, performance points, and even complete engine failure. That is why understanding the commonest Ford diesel engine repair mistakes is so important.
One of the biggest mistakes owners make is ignoring early warning signs. A rough idle, hard starts, excessive smoke, lack of energy, or poor fuel financial system ought to never be brushed off as minor issues. Ford diesel engines typically give clear signals when something is fallacious, particularly with components like injectors, turbochargers, glow plugs, and the fuel system. Waiting too long to diagnose these symptoms can turn a comparatively affordable repair into a major engine problem.
One other severe mistake is using the fallacious diagnostic approach. Many people assume a diesel situation can be recognized based only on sound or visible symptoms. Modern Ford diesel engines rely closely on electronic control systems, sensors, and onboard diagnostics. Guessing instead of scanning for hassle codes and properly testing components can lead to unnecessary part replacements and wasted money. A correct analysis ought to always come before any repair attempt.
Using low-cost or low-quality replacement parts is another problem that causes long-term trouble. Diesel engines operate under high pressure and intense heat, so parts need to fulfill strict quality standards. Low-grade injectors, gaskets, sensors, or filters might cost less upfront, but they usually fail faster and may create bigger issues down the road. In Ford diesel repair, cutting corners on parts can simply lead to repeated breakdowns and expensive labor bills.
Many repair mistakes additionally occur because people overlook the importance of fuel system cleanliness. Ford diesel engines are extraordinarily sensitive to contamination. Dirt, water, or debris entering the fuel system can damage injectors, pumps, and other precision components. During repairs, even a small quantity of contamination can create major problems. Clean tools, clean work areas, and proper dealing with of fuel system parts are essential. Skipping this level of care is a mistake that may damage an otherwise simple repair.
Failing to replace related components throughout a repair is another challenge that always leads to repeat failures. For instance, if a turbocharger is replaced without checking oil provide lines, intercooler contamination, or associated sensors, the new turbo might not last long. The same applies to injector repairs, EGR system work, or head gasket replacement. Focusing only on the failed part without addressing the underlying cause is among the most costly mistakes a Ford diesel owner can make.
Incorrect torque specifications are also a major concern. Ford diesel engines require very exact torque settings for parts like head bolts, injector hold-downs, and different critical fasteners. Over-tightening can damage threads, warp parts, or cause cracks. Under-tightening may end up in leaks, poor sealing, and mechanical failure. Anybody working on a Ford diesel engine ought to always follow producer specs instead of relying on guesswork or general experience.
Neglecting oil and coolant requirements is one other repair mistake that should never happen. Ford diesel engines depend on the right oil grade and coolant type for proper lubrication, temperature control, and emission system performance. Using the improper fluids can harm the engine, clog cooling passages, or damage emission-related components. After any repair, fluid levels and fluid quality ought to be checked carefully. This is very necessary in diesel engines that operate under heavy loads or in demanding conditions.
One frequent error with Ford diesel repair is failing to address emission system parts properly. Systems like EGR coolers, DPF units, and DEF components are deeply integrated into engine performance. Some owners try temporary fixes or bypass methods that create bigger issues later. Poor repairs in these systems can trigger warning lights, reduce power, damage fuel effectivity, and even put the truck into limp mode. Proper repair strategies are always higher than shortcuts.
Another mistake is skipping common upkeep after a repair is completed. Some drivers assume that once a major repair is finished, the engine will take care of itself for a long time. In reality, repaired diesel engines still need routine oil changes, fuel filter replacements, cooling system service, and inspections. Maintenance helps protect the repair investment and reduces the probabilities of the same concern coming back.
Trying to handle advanced repairs without the proper skill level is one other risk. Basic maintenance could also be manageable for some owners, but complex diesel repairs require specialized tools, technical knowledge, and experience. Jobs involving high-pressure fuel systems, timing components, injectors, or inside engine parts should not be treated as trial-and-error projects. A single mistake can damage expensive elements and increase downtime.
